Per convertire una stringa in un numero, in C++, usa gli stringstream:
Codice PHP:
#include <iostream>
#include <sstream>
#include <string>
using namespace std;
template <typename T>
T parse(string str)
{
stringstream ss;
T t;
ss << str;
ss >> t;
return t;
}
int main()
{
int x;
double y;
int z;
x = parse<int>("-144");
y = parse<double>("-87.98");
z = parse<int>("12312");
cout << x << endl;
cout << y << endl;
cout << z << endl;
return 0;
}
![]()